One of the options in the challenge was that bandwidth was constrained over the internet gateway when peering. This was discounted because there are no bandwidth constraints on IG but would it be used by peering anyway?
AWS uses the existing infrastructure of a VPC to create a VPC peering connection; it is neither a gateway nor a AWS Site-to-Site VPN connection.
The connection is private and is not exposed to the public internet.
